Before You Cancel Things to Check

Before proceeding to cancel Empower subscription, it is helpful to review your account status. Some users may have active advances, pending transactions, or linked bank accounts that need attention.

Canceling the subscription does not always remove all app access immediately, so understanding what happens next can prevent confusion.

Outstanding Balances

If you have used cash advance features, make sure you understand any repayment obligations. Canceling a subscription does not erase outstanding balances.

Billing Cycle Timing

Subscription services often bill at specific intervals. Canceling just before the renewal date can help avoid additional charges.

How to Cancel Empower Subscription Step by Step

The process to cancel Empower subscription is typically handled within the app itself. While the exact steps may vary slightly due to updates, the general process remains user-friendly.

Accessing Account Settings

Start by opening the app and navigating to your account or profile section. This area usually contains subscription and billing information.

Managing Subscription Options

Within settings, look for a section related to membership, subscription, or billing. Here, you should find an option to cancel or manage your plan.

Confirming Cancellation

Most platforms require confirmation to prevent accidental cancellations. Carefully read any on-screen messages before finalizing your decision.

What Happens After You Cancel

Once you cancel Empower subscription, premium features typically remain available until the end of the current billing period. After that, access may be limited or reverted to a basic version.

You should receive a confirmation message or email indicating that your cancellation request was successful.

Will You Still Owe Money After Cancellation?

Canceling a subscription does not automatically cancel financial obligations. If you used services such as cash advances, repayment is still required according to the original terms.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Canceling

One common mistake is assuming that deleting the app automatically cancels the subscription. In most cases, subscription management must be done through account settings.

Another mistake is canceling without checking billing dates, which can lead to unexpected charges.
